Herald-Standard poll
There was too much media coverage of singer Michael Jackson’s death, according to a majority of those taking part in a a poll on the Herald-Standard’s Web site, heraldstandard.com. Of the 830 people who took part in the poll, 87.2 percent said the coverage was too much. Another 10.5 percent said the coverage was just about right and 2.3 percent said the coverage was not enough.
